Toyota Material Handling (TMH) has announced the launch of a new energy solutions platform designed to help the materials handling industry meet the complex demands of evolving equipment, the environmental landscape, and energy management requirements.

Toyota Industrial Energy Solutions encompasses a suite of energy solutions to meet the current and future demands of materials handling, including on-site consultation, environmental support, battery and alternative energy sources, chargers and accessories, and service and repair.

Toyota Industrial Energy Solutions utilises resources that it claims are unique to the Toyota dealer network, allowing customers to increase efficiency and optimise their operations. Through the new platform, Toyota forklift dealers can perform energy studies to highlight information and pinpoint efficiencies that optimise overall operational productivity.

"This is the next step on our journey to become a full-line provider of innovative, sustainable energy solutions for the materials handling industry," says Toyota Material Handling senior vice president Tony Miller. "As the market evolves and customers demand environmentally sustainable ways to power their forklifts, we will offer energy-saving and waste-reducing solutions nobody else in the industry can because of Toyota's commitment to quality and our unmatched dealer network."

Toyota's latest UL-rated lithium-ion battery line-up is part of the company's aggressive offering of alternative energy solutions to its customers. Toyota claims to be the first and only manufacturer in the industry to obtain UL-E and UL-EE certification for the combination of lift truck and lithium-ion batteries on a sit-down counterbalance forklift. Over 50 lithium-ion battery solutions have now been tested and approved by Toyota for use across its electric forklift line-up.

"We remain committed to delivering the best products and services in the materials handling industry, and that extends to alternative energy solutions," Miller says. "Our customers count on us to offer versatile solutions that are also reliable and safe. Toyota Industrial Energy Solutions will help customers as they encounter evolving environmental standards and increasing throughput demands."
